For the first 50 m, the tram moved at a speed of 5 m-s, and the next 500 m at a speed of 10 m-s. Determine the average speed of the tram along the entire route.

V Wed = S (all distance) / t (all time)
50 + 500 = 550 m – all the way
50/5 = 10 m / s – speed in the first section
500/10 = 50 m / s – speed in the second section
V Wed = 550 / (10 + 50) = 550/60 = 9.16 m / s
Answer: V cf. = 9.16 m / s
